Schroff, the electronic enclosures specialist, has launched a new equipment case series Ratiopac PRO is designed to give a high degree of technical sophistication at an economical price

The case, which is an enclosed subrack, is particularly suited to measurement, instrumentation and control applications.

It can be configured either as a portable desktop case or as a 19 inch plug in unit.

The ratiopac PRO series is available as either a space optimised 3, 4 or 6 U unit or a 4, 5 or 7 U unit with integral ventilation.

Side panels and horizontal rails are constructed from lightweight aluminium.

Front handles and trims are manufactured from die cast aluminium.

Painted grey and with no screw heads visible, ratiopac PRO is aesthetically pleasing.

The appearance is further enhanced by the virtually seamless transition between panels.

Quick and easy accessibility is achieved by the use of a single clip fastener to allow covers and side panels to be removed without the need for special tools.

Even the most basic version of ratiopac PRO features a high level of EMC shielding, with attenuation greater than 25dB at 1GHz.

The degree of shielding can be easily upgraded if required.

The interior layout of ratiopac PRO means that users can take advantage of the full range of schroff's subrack accessories that include handles, backplanes, front panels and board guides.

All models in the range comply with IEC60297, its revision, and the new IEEE1101.10/.11 standard.
